Short-term drug rehab and alcohol treatment services in Gulf Shores, Alabama are typically delivered in a residential or inpatient setting for a time period of 30 days or less. While long term drug treatment requires at least a 90 day stay and a much more rigorous course of treatment, short-term drug rehab and alcohol treatment services work to get the addicted person abstinent through detox followed by a short course of counseling and therapy to lightly deal with emotional addiction issues. Because it usually takes several weeks if not months to truly address everything which could hang the person up and trigger relapse once they go back into the real world, short-term drug rehab and alcohol treatment services may not be recommended for those in Gulf Shores, AL. who have a long termaddiction and/or dependence to drugs and alcohol.
